Hartsig Park is a park in Michigan, at a modelled 191 m. Oakland Heights Landfill stands 388 m to the north-northwest, 17 miles off. The nearest named place is Butcher Park, a park 0.9 miles away. Woodward Avenue (M-1) - Automotive Heritage Trail passes 3.9 miles off. 12 named summits stand within 25 miles.

| Jan | Feb | Mar | Apr | May | Jun | Jul | Aug | Sep | Oct | Nov | Dec |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Avg °F | 26 | 28 | 37 | 48 | 60 | 70 | 74 | 73 | 65 | 53 | 41 | 32 |
| Precip in | 1.4 | 1.4 | 2.0 | 2.8 | 3.5 | 3.1 | 3.2 | 3.1 | 3.1 | 2.3 | 2.2 | 1.7 |
1991–2020 U.S. Climate Normals, NOAA NCEI — Detroit City AP, 7 mi away.
